Adsorption of Salicylic Acid from Aqueous Solutions on Microporous Granular Activated Carbon
Solid Fuel Chemistry ( IF 0.7 ) Pub Date : 2021-04-16 , DOI: 10.3103/s0361521921020063
A. K. Rakishev , M. D. Vedenyapina , S. A. Kulaishin , D. V. Kurilov

Abstract

The kinetics of adsorption of salicylic acid from aqueous solutions on microporous granular activated carbon (GAC) was studied. The high adsorption capacity of GAC for this substance was shown. The order of adsorption of salicylic acid and the activation energy of adsorption were determined.
